Архитектура взаимодействующих информационных систем

Архитектура взаимодействующих информационных систем (AIOS) — это эталонная архитектура для разработки совместимых информационных систем предприятия . Если предприятия или государственные администрации хотят участвовать в автоматизированных бизнес-процессах с другими организациями, их ИТ-системы должны иметь возможность работать вместе, т. е. они должны быть совместимыми . AIOS представляет собой общий план построения для этих организаций, позволяющий разрабатывать совместимые информационные системы путем систематической корректировки и расширения их внутренних информационных систем.AIOS был описан в докторской диссертации и основан на результатах различных исследовательских проектов по совместимости. [1] Он не зависит от конкретных продуктов или поставщиков, но в общих чертах описывает различные уровни, представления, отношения и технические средства, необходимые для эффективного создания совместимых информационных систем. С этой целью он сочетает в себе концепции сервис-ориентированной архитектуры , совместного бизнеса и моделирования бизнес-процессов . Его можно рассматривать как дополнение к ARIS , известной архитектуре внутренних информационных систем и бизнес-процессов.
Определение
[ редактировать ]Подобно автоматизации процессов внутри организаций, автоматизация межорганизационных бизнес-процессов является важной тенденцией. В этом стремлении сотрудничающие организации скорее стремятся к слабой связи своих информационных систем, а не к тесной интеграции : сотрудничающие информационные системы должны иметь возможность работать вместе, но сохранять как можно большую независимость. Эту характеристику также называют функциональной совместимостью или, в контексте сотрудничающих организаций, бизнес-интероперабельностью , то есть способностью автономных организаций выполнять совместный бизнес-процесс между собой.
Информационные системы – это системы, которые обрабатывают информацию, т.е. они собирают, транспортируют, преобразовывают, хранят и предлагают информацию. Согласно концепции, преобладающей в исследованиях информационных систем, информационная система включает в себя не только аппаратное и программное обеспечение предприятия, но также связанных с ним людей, бизнес-функции и процессы, а также организационные структуры. [2] Это широкое понимание, например, также воплощено в рамках Захмана .
Архитектура определяется как «фундаментальная организация системы, воплощенная в ее компонентах, их отношениях друг с другом и окружающей средой, а также принципах, управляющих ее проектированием и развитием». [3] Синц определяет архитектуру информационной системы как план построения информационной системы в смысле спецификации и документации ее компонентов и их взаимосвязей, охватывающих все соответствующие точки зрения, а также правил построения для создания плана здания. [4]
Соответственно, архитектуру взаимодействующих информационных систем можно определить как план построения межорганизационной информационной системы, которая позволяет организациям выполнять совместные бизнес-процессы между собой.
Предыстория и применение
[ редактировать ]По итогам работы над совместимыми информационными системами, проведенной в рамках европейских исследовательских проектов [5] в 2010 году была опубликована «Архитектура взаимодействующих информационных систем» (AIOS) как справочник по построению слабосвязанных взаимодействующих информационных систем и систематическому внедрению совместных бизнес-процессов на основе моделей.
AIOS ориентирован в первую очередь на крупные организации, которые хотят взаимодействовать друг с другом. С этой целью он описывает, как внутренние элементы информационной системы могут быть систематически связаны с информационными системами партнеров по сотрудничеству. Основными элементами AIOS являются:
- Описание различных типов данных, содержащихся в интероперабельной информационной системе, а также их взаимосвязей. Это также называется статической частью или структурой архитектуры. Он сообщает организациям, какие информационные элементы (например, описания сообщений, последовательности обмена, роли и услуги) они должны предоставить партнерам по сотрудничеству и как они могут оптимально соотнести их с внутренними элементами.
- Описание различных путей создания или настройки совместимых информационных систем. Это также называется динамической частью архитектуры. Он сообщает организации, как итеративно разрабатывать элементы, упомянутые выше.
- Концепция технических компонентов, необходимых для реализации архитектуры, например, инструментов проектирования, внутренних и внешних репозиториев.
Одним из элементов, включенных в третью категорию, является «BII-репозиторий» , в котором каждая организация публикует содержимое своего интерфейса бизнес-интероперабельности (BII) для партнеров по сотрудничеству. Поскольку он включает в себя внешние представления элементов информационной системы, он обеспечивает функции публикации и обнаружения, необходимые в сервис-ориентированной архитектуре : В BII внешне релевантные процессы, услуги, организационные структуры и т. д. описываются на различных уровнях технической детализации, позволяя другим организациям искать также элементы бизнес-уровня, а не только технические артефакты. Здесь, в отличие от традиционного подхода SOA, вместо одного центрального каталога служб реализуются различные репозитории, специфичные для партнеров.
Структура
[ редактировать ]Статическая часть архитектуры построена на трех ортогональных осях: измерениях предприятия, уровнях технической детализации и представлениях для совместной работы.
Совместные просмотры
[ редактировать ]Подобно частным, общедоступным и глобальным представлениям, известным из моделирования бизнес-процессов и рабочих процессов, в AIOS предоставляются соответствующие частные, общедоступные и глобальные представления об элементах информационной системы.
- Частное представление содержит единственные видимые внутри элементы информационной системы.
- Общее представление действует как интерфейс к внутренним, частным элементам системы; он защищает внутренние системы и обеспечивает совместимость без необходимости значительных изменений во внутренних системах. Это общедоступное представление описывает границы информационной системы организации для ее партнеров по сотрудничеству и соединяет внутренние и внешние информационные системы, тем самым также предоставляя содержимое интерфейса бизнес-совместимости организации.
- Глобальное представление можно использовать для корреляции и соединения общедоступных представлений различных систем.
Размеры предприятия
[ редактировать ]Для всестороннего описания бизнес-процессов эта ось обеспечивает четкое представление о процессах, функциях, данных и организационных элементах.
- В организационном измерении описываются роли, подразделения и другие организационные элементы, имеющие отношение к сотрудничеству, которые связаны с внутренними элементами. Это гарантирует, например, что партнеры по сотрудничеству имеют общее понимание взаимодействующих ролей.
- В измерении данных типы документов, используемые в сотрудничестве, определяются и связаны с типами документов, используемыми внутри компании.
- В функциональном измерении описываются бизнес-функции и услуги, предлагаемые в рамках сотрудничества.
- В измерении процесса описываются процессы, которые предлагает каждая организация, а также то, как эти общедоступные процессы связаны со смежными процессами партнерских организаций.
Таким образом, в сочетании с осью «совместные взгляды» частные, публичные и глобальные взгляды на процессы, функции, данные и организационные роли предоставляются .
Уровни технической детализации
[ редактировать ]Описание элементов системы на разных уровнях технической детализации поддерживает систематическую разработку совместных информационных систем, начиная с определения бизнес-требований и заканчивая уровнем кода. Помимо аспекта построения, тем самым обеспечивается также многомерное описание совместимости, облегчающее синхронизацию взаимодействующих систем на каждом уровне. Аналогично, например, ARIS и OMG MDA, используются три уровня:
- Бизнес-уровень : здесь процессы, подлежащие автоматизации, описываются с уровня, независимого от техники. В MDA этот уровень называется уровнем CIM.
- Технический уровень : Здесь описывается концепция ИТ. Поэтому модели первого уровня технически обогащаются, например, вместо бизнес-функций теперь описываются компоненты, но все еще на грубом, концептуальном уровне. Поскольку модели второго уровня представляют собой основу для автоматизированной генерации исполняемого кода, их, возможно, придется дополнительно адаптировать, чтобы они соответствовали ограничениям уровня реализации.
- Уровень выполнения : здесь модели интерпретируются машиной и могут использоваться во время выполнения при выполнении процессов.
Ссылки
[ редактировать ]- ^ Циманн (2010): Архитектура взаимодействующих информационных систем - основанный на модели предприятия подход к описанию и реализации совместных бизнес-процессов. Logos, 2010. Компания Logos была так любезна, что разрешила бесплатно скачать копию здесь . Краткое изложение можно найти здесь: Ziemann (2012): Архитектура взаимодействующих информационных систем – эталонная архитектура для сотрудничества между государственными администрациями. В: Кроллманн Х., Цапп А. (ред.): Bausteine einer vernetzten Verwaltung. Берлин, Эрих Шмидт Верлаг, 2012, стр. 165.
- ^ Сравните, например, Becker & Schütte (2004, стр. 33): Коммерческие информационные системы. Предметно-ориентированное введение в бизнес-информатику, 2-е издание, Redline Economic, Франкфурт или Габриэль (2008): Информационная система. Энциклопедия бизнес-информатики, онлайн-лексикон. Ольденбург Виссеншафтсверлаг, Германия.
- ^ IEEE (2007): Веб-сайт IEEE 1471, IEEE Std. 1471 Часто задаваемые вопросы (FAQ) — версия 5.0, 19 июля 2007 г. http://www.iso-architecture.org/ieee-1471/ieee-1471-faq.html. Архивировано 28 августа 2011 г. в Wayback Machine , ac. - прекращено: май 2009 г.
- ^ Синц (2002): Архитектура информационных систем. В: Рехнерберг П., Помбергер Г. (ред.): Справочник по информатике. 3-е издание, Hanser, Мюнхен, стр. 1055–1068.
- ^ Interop NOE (2004–2007 гг., номер проекта IST-2004-508011), ATHENA (2004–2007 гг., «Передовые технологии взаимодействия гетерогенных корпоративных сетей и их применение», номер проекта IST-2004-507849) или R4eGov (2006–2006 гг.) 2009 г., номер проекта ИСТ-2004-026650)